A Douglas woman who assaulted a police officer at her home will be sentenced in May.
29-year-old Cherona Leigh Crossman, of Governors Hill, admitted the offence at Douglas Courthouse earlier this week.
She also entered a guilty plea to a charge of provoking behaviour - both offences were committed on March 28th.
Social enquiry reports have been requested before she's sentenced on May 18th.
